Driveway Lighting Installation in Olathe, KS
Driveway lighting installation enhances both the safety and aesthetic appeal of residential properties by illuminating pathways and driveways during nighttime hours. This service covers a variety of projects, including installing new lighting fixtures along existing driveways, upgrading outdated systems, or adding decorative lighting to highlight landscape features. Property owners often seek driveway lighting to improve visibility when parking or navigating after dark, as well as to create a welcoming atmosphere around their home.
Before requesting driveway lighting installation, homeowners typically want to understand the different lighting options available, such as LED fixtures, solar-powered lights, or low-voltage systems, as well as how the placement can influence both functionality and curb appeal. It’s also common to consider the overall design to ensure the lighting complements the property’s style, and to inquire about the durability and weather resistance of the fixtures to ensure long-lasting performance.

Driveway Lighting Installation Questions
What types of driveway lighting are available? There are various options including pathway lights, floodlights, and accent lights to enhance safety and curb appeal.
How does driveway lighting improve safety? Proper lighting reduces the risk of trips and falls by illuminating pathways and potential obstacles at night.
Can driveway lighting be customized to match property style? Yes, lighting fixtures and placement can be tailored to complement the design and aesthetic of the property.
Is driveway lighting suitable for all driveway types? Driveway lighting can be installed on different surfaces and styles, including concrete, pavers, and gravel driveways.
